The Day of the Dead, or Da de Muertos, is a vibrant and deeply meaningful holiday celebrated primarily in Mexico and parts of Latin America. Far from being a somber occasion, it’s a joyful remembrance of loved ones who have passed on, a time when families come together to honor their ancestors and keep their memories alive. A key element in these celebrations is the decoration of homes and altars, often with bright colors, marigolds, sugar skulls, and, increasingly, festive banners. 1. Exploring the Symbolism
A truly captivating Day of the Dead banner isn’t just about aesthetics; it’s about incorporating the rich symbolism that makes this holiday so meaningful. Understanding these symbols can help you choose a banner that truly resonates with the spirit of Da de Muertos. The most iconic symbol is undoubtedly the calavera, or skull. These aren’t meant to be scary or morbid; instead, they represent the departed souls and are often depicted with cheerful smiles and colorful decorations. Sugar skulls, in particular, are a popular motif, representing the sweetness of life and the memories of loved ones. Marigolds, or cempaschil, are another essential element. Their vibrant orange color is believed to guide the spirits back to the land of the living, and their petals are often used to create pathways leading to altars. Papel picado, or perforated paper banners, are another classic decoration. The intricate designs symbolize the fragility of life and the connection between the living and the dead. Look for banners that incorporate these traditional elements in creative and visually appealing ways. Beyond the traditional symbols, consider banners that incorporate personal elements as well. Perhaps a banner featuring the favorite flowers of a loved one, or one that includes images of their hobbies or passions. The more personal the banner, the more meaningful it will be. When choosing a printable banner, pay attention to the color palette as well. Day of the Dead is a celebration of life, so bright and vibrant colors are key. Think oranges, yellows, pinks, and purples. Avoid overly somber or dark colors, as they don’t align with the joyful spirit of the holiday. The type of paper you use will significantly impact the final look and feel of your banner. For a more durable banner that can be reused year after year, consider printing on cardstock or heavier paper. If you’re going for a more delicate look, standard printer paper will work just fine. Pay attention to the print settings as well. Make sure your printer is set to print in color and at the highest quality setting for the best results. Before printing the entire banner, it’s always a good idea to print a test page to ensure the colors are accurate and the design is properly aligned. Once you’ve printed all the pages of your banner, it’s time to assemble them. You can use scissors or a paper cutter to trim the excess paper around the edges of each page. Then, use tape, glue, or staples to connect the pages together. For a more professional look, consider laminating the individual pages before assembling them. This will protect the banner from moisture and make it more durable. Finally, string the banner together using ribbon, twine, or yarn. You can punch holes in the top corners of each page or simply tape the string to the back.
